Note
Access to this page requires authorization. You can try signing in or changing directories.
Access to this page requires authorization. You can try changing directories.
Creates a new instance of RPayCalcYearsForAverage class.
Syntax
server public static RPayCalcYearsForAverage construct(
    RHRMEmplId _emplId, 
    Counter _yearsToCalc, 
    ReportPeriod_RU _currentPeriod, 
   [boolean _recalcByPrevYears, 
    boolean _exclDaysApplicable, 
    boolean _onlyCurrentEmployer])
Run On
Server
Parameters
- _emplId
 Type: RHRMEmplId Extended Data Type
 The code of employee.
- _yearsToCalc
 Type: Counter Extended Data Type
 The number of years to calculate.
- _currentPeriod
 Type: ReportPeriod_RU Extended Data Type
 The current period.
- _recalcByPrevYears
 Type: boolean
 if true then some years could be replaced by another.
- _exclDaysApplicable
 Type: boolean
 If true then the excluded days decrease days.
- _onlyCurrentEmployer
 Type: boolean
 If true then calculation is performing for current employer.
Return Value
Type: RPayCalcYearsForAverage Class
The instance of RPayCalcYearsForAverage class.